What are the earth-bonding requirements for exterior CCTV cameras?
I've just got into doing a big project and there is a lot of confusion out there because different countries have different rules.
On one end of the scale are people saying there must be a lightning strike rated surge protector at the ingress point of every camera cable, bonded to earth using at least 6awg cable. On the other end are people saying it's entirely optional.
I can't work it out in my head... yes surely a lightning strike might cause a fire if it over-loaded the thin data cables into the house... but at the same time, my aerial, sky dish, exterior lights etc are all out on the walls with nothing more than, at best, a passive shunt.
What are the regs for this stuff?
